Like many people, I use Twitter to keep up to date with gaming news and to tweet about gaming news. A few hours ago I tried to go to the site, only to be confronted by the image you see above.
Over capacity? I take this to mean that so many people are using Twitter at the same time that their servers are having trouble handling the load.
Now, what could possibly be going on today that’s causing a lot more people to tweet a lot more than usual? Perhaps something that starts with an E and ends with a 3?
It’s not too far-fetched. We’ve had quite a few major press conferences today, with companies revealing some unbelievable pieces of news. Imagine hundreds of viewers (journalists, developers, bigwig producers, and of course gamers) tweeting away at the same time on their iPhones, Blackberries, and other devices.
The Twitter site was down for at least two hours, but it’s up and running now. Unless Twitter somehow works around it, I have a feeling that we may see this error message a few more times over the next three days.
